Question : DRDO Projects

(a) whether the Government has provided any funds to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O) for the development of innovative, intelligent and state-of-art technology gadgets in the country during the last three years and the current year; and

(b) if so, the details thereof along with the funds earmarked and allocated for various DRDO projects during the said period?

(a) & (b):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O), an R&D Wing of Ministry of Defence, is primarily involved in design and development of strategic, complex and security sensitive systems in the fields of armaments, missiles, unmanned aerial vehicles, radars, electronic warfare systems, sonars, combat vehicles, combat aircraft, sensors, etc for the Armed Forces as per their specific Qualitative Requirements.
Details of expenditure made by the Department of Defence Research and Development during the last three years and current year are given below:

Year Expenditure
(Rs. in crore)
2013-14 10868.88
2014-15 13257.98
2015-16 13277.27
2016-17
(BE) 13593.78

Details of major projects (cost more than Rs. 100 Cr. sanctioned since 1st January, 2014 are given at Annexure ‘A’.
